Case Study
Cooper Tire Transforms Operations with MES
Cooper Tire & Rubber Company improved operational visibility and production efficiency through the implementation of a Manufacturing Execution System (MES). By integrating real-time data and standardizing processes, the company enhanced quality control, reduced downtime, and optimized overall plant performance—enabling more efficient and consistent tire manufacturing operations.
Case Study
Hirata boosts efficiency with emulation software
Hirata Corporation leveraged advanced emulation software to optimize system design, improve testing accuracy, and accelerate deployment. By simulating real-world production environments, the company reduced commissioning time, minimized risk, and improved overall automation performance—enabling more efficient and reliable manufacturing operations.
